Key Iowa rules to know
A few state-specific facts pulled straight from the questions in our Iowa bank:
- Iowa allows an instruction permit at age 14 (one of the youngest).
- Never drive faster than is reasonable and proper for conditions.
- Iowa calls the offense Operating While Intoxicated (OWI).
- Meeting a school bus with amber lights: slow to 20 mph or less and be ready to stop.
- Good tread and fully clearing snow/ice from windows are essential in Iowa winters.
Source: Official Iowa Driver's Manual. Always confirm current rules with your official Iowa driver handbook.

How old do I have to be to get a Iowa permit?
You must be at least 14 in Iowa to start the permit process. Some states also require a driver-education or supervised-driving step — check your Iowa driver licensing agency for the exact requirements.
